THE ESSEX GREEN

Cannibal Sea

2006-03-08

The Essex Green is a band based in Brooklyn, NY. Their new album, Cannibal Sea, blends old with the new, incorporating the country rock mood of The Byrds, the Greenwich Village balladry of Fred Neil and the acoustic pop harmonizing of The Mamas and the Papas. Add a little of the pure pop perfection of The Monkees to traces of contemporary artists such as The Shins, and you have The Essex Green. - Michele Tolo
